Некоторые особенности архитектуры хранения данных в ClickHouse:
Столбцовое хранение. 23 Позволяет считывать данные только из нужных колонок и эффективно сжимать однотипную информацию. 2
Физическая сортировка данных по первичному ключу. 2 Позволяет быстро получать конкретные значения или диапазоны. 2
Векторные вычисления по кусочкам столбцов. 2 Снижают издержки на диспетчеризацию и позволяют более эффективно использовать CPU. 2
Распараллеливание операций. 2 Происходит как в пределах одного сервера на несколько процессорных ядер, так и в рамках распределённых вычислений на кластере за счёт механизма шардирования. 2
Поддержка приближённых вычислений на части выборки. 2 Это снижает число обращений к жёсткому диску и ещё больше повышает скорость обработки данных. 2
Быстрое сжатие данных. 4 За счёт использования современных алгоритмов компрессии LZ4 и ZSTD данные не только занимают меньше места в хранилище, но и значительно быстрее обрабатываются. 4
Ответ сформирован YandexGPT на основе текстов выбранных сайтов. В нём могут быть неточности.
Примеры полезных ответов Нейро на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Нейро.